This paper addresses energy-aware control in a wireless control system. The goal is to save energy in a smart sensor node by codesigning its use of the radio chip together with the control policy. The focus is on exploiting the fact that in many radio chips used in wireless nodes the depth of sleep can be manipulated dynamically. This paper proposes an event-based scheme to control a networked control system and to manage the radio-modes of its smart sensor node. The smart node is battery driven and is in charge of sensing the system and computing the control law which is sent to the receiver using a wireless channel. Energy efficiency is one of the main issues in wireless Networked Control Systems. The control community has already shown large interest in the topics of intermittent control and event-based control, allowing to turn off the radio of the nodes, which is the main energy consumer, on longer time intervals than in the periodic case.
